The Medical Assistant or LPN is responsible for general clinical and procedural patient care for approximately 30 patients per day. Key duties include rooming patients, collecting vitals, administering injections, and maintaining detailed documentation.
Candidates must be a Certified Medical Assistant or LPN with a high school diploma and graduation from a recognized program. Proficiency in EPIC EMR, ICD-10/CPT coding, and HIPAA laws is strongly preferred.
1. High School diploma or equivalent certificate 2. Qualified applicants must be a Certified Medical Assistant, and will have graduated from a recognized Medical Assistant program. 3. Prior experience in ambulatory health care facility preferred 4. Ability to learn related center tasks and be of assistance to management and physicians. 5. Self-motivated to achieve the highest patient care and customer service standards. 6. CPR certified within the first 3 months of employment. 7. Knowledge of ICD-10 and CPT coding 8. Familiarity with the EPIC EMR is strongly preferred. 9. Thorough understanding of HIPAA law.
